D-modules in geometry and physics
Final Report Abstract
The notion of a D-module which is a generalization of a linear partial differential equation was introduced by Kashiwara at the beginning of the 70’s. Through the Riemann-Hilbert correspondence they are closely linked with perverse sheaves whose basic building blocks are the intersection complexes of Goresky and MacPherson. D-modules turned out to be an indispensable tool to study singularities of maps between algebraic varieties. These D-modules of ”geometric origin” carry an extra structures, namely so-called Hodge and weight filtrations which are notoriously difficult to compute. One of the major achievements of this project so far was the explicit calculation of these two filtrations in the case of the Gelfand-Kapranov-Zelevinsky hypergeometric systems which are closely related to the geometry of Laurent polynomials in several variables. These maps play a prominent role in mirror symmetry since they serve as Landau- Ginzburg mirror partners for complete intersections in toric varieties. Here mirror symmetry provides a mysterious duality between enumerative geometry of algebraic varieties, captured by the quantum cohomology, on one side and highly transcendental period integrals, captured by D-modules, on the other side. The explicit knowledge of the Hodge filtration on the GKZ-system enabled us to prove a conjecture of Katzarkov-Kontsevich-Pantev on the existence of a non-commutative Hodge structure on the quantum cohomology of a projective variety.
